The Impact of Federal Water Policy on State Planning: A Cautionary Example
Long‐term water policy reform would be more successful if the federal government accepted state water system laws and cooperated with the states to ensure that the reforms are workable and that the affected local and state agencies are involved in their planning. A review of California's experience illustrates the present potential for conflict.
